According to The Insight Partners, Global Active B12 Test Market is projected to reach US$ 251.5 million by 2034, growing from US$ 182.25 million in 2025, at a CAGR of 3.64% during the forecast period of 2026–2034. The market is experiencing steady expansion due to increasing awareness regarding vitamin B12 deficiency, rising demand for accurate diagnostic solutions, and growing emphasis on preventive healthcare worldwide. Active B12 testing has become an essential diagnostic tool because it measures holotranscobalamin—the biologically active fraction of vitamin B12—which provides more accurate and earlier detection of deficiency compared to conventional serum vitamin B12 tests.

Vitamin B12 deficiency has emerged as a significant global health concern, particularly among older adults, pregnant women, vegetarians, vegans, and patients suffering from gastrointestinal disorders. Since vitamin B12 plays a crucial role in neurological function, red blood cell formation, and DNA synthesis, early diagnosis has become increasingly important for preventing irreversible health complications. Healthcare professionals are gradually shifting toward active B12 testing as it enables earlier intervention and improved patient outcomes.

The growing incidence of chronic diseases further supports the expansion of the Active B12 Test Market. Conditions such as diabetes, gastrointestinal diseases, autoimmune disorders, and chronic kidney disease often interfere with vitamin B12 absorption. Additionally, long-term use of medications including metformin and proton pump inhibitors has been associated with vitamin B12 deficiency, increasing the need for routine monitoring through reliable diagnostic methods.

The aging global population represents another major growth driver. Older adults frequently experience reduced vitamin B12 absorption due to age-related physiological changes, making routine screening increasingly necessary. Early diagnosis allows healthcare providers to implement timely treatment strategies that reduce complications associated with cognitive decline, anemia, neuropathy, and other health conditions related to vitamin B12 deficiency.
